dd-trace-rb icon indicating copy to clipboard operation
dd-trace-rb copied to clipboard

Support Data Streams Monitoring (DSM)

Open mitchellmaler opened this issue 2 years ago • 15 comments

Is your feature request related to a problem? Please describe. We would like to use Data Streams Monitoring for our different Ruby apps, but we noticed it is not listed in the supported languages here: https://docs.datadoghq.com/data_streams/#setup

Describe the goal of the feature Add DSM to the Ruby Tracer

Describe alternatives you've considered None

Additional context None

How does ddtrace help you? N/A

mitchellmaler avatar Oct 26 '23 17:10 mitchellmaler

I'll pass this request to the Data Streams Monitoring team. I'll see if they have an official response here.

marcotc avatar Oct 26 '23 20:10 marcotc

@marcotc, Any update from the team yet?

hallucinations avatar Nov 14 '23 17:11 hallucinations

@marcotc Any update from the team yet?

flaviogf avatar Jan 22 '24 14:01 flaviogf

One more thumbs up for this feature! My team is looking forwards to it

vinicius0197 avatar Jan 22 '24 17:01 vinicius0197

Hey folks thanks for reminding us! Please do continue to :+1: so we can let the powers that be :tm: know there's a lot of interest on Ruby support for this :)

ivoanjo avatar Mar 20 '24 15:03 ivoanjo

A question for everyone that is interested in this feature: What libraries/gems/frameworks are you using that would benefit from Data Streams Monitoring?

I'm gathering information so we know which systems to integrate with first in Ruby.

marcotc avatar Apr 18 '24 21:04 marcotc

@marcotc We use Racecar (rdkafka) to produce / consume Kafka messages. It'd be great if dd-trace-rb added support.

sco11morgan avatar May 28 '24 13:05 sco11morgan

@marcotc karafka users here, we'd really appreciate the support

tukak avatar Jul 17 '24 13:07 tukak

@marcotc, Checking in to see if there have been any updates. We use Karafka and Racecar.

hallucinations avatar Aug 07 '24 06:08 hallucinations

👍

darrencauthon avatar Aug 07 '24 13:08 darrencauthon

We are actively working on it as of recently! 🙌 There are many facets to this (SNS/SQS, Kafka, how to represent each distributed connection for each framework, backend support), but we are internally working towards delivering DSM for Ruby.

marcotc avatar Aug 07 '24 22:08 marcotc